Donaire pinupuntirya ng 2-boxers
MANILA, Philippines - Ngayon pa lamang ay may boksingero nang tinitingnan si five-division world champion Nonito ‘The Filipino Flash’ Donaire, Jr. sakaling manalo kay Jessie Magdaleno sa Nobyembre 6 (Manila time) sa Thomas & Mack Center sa Las Vegas, Nevada.
Dalawa sa mga ito, ayon kay Donaire (37-3-0, 24 KOs) ay sina Carl Frampton (23-0-0, 14 KOs) at Leo Santa Cruz (32-1-1, 18 KOs), mag-aagawan para sa WBA featherweight title sa Enero 28, 2017.
“The truth is that if I win on November 5th, the next thing I want to do is going against Leo Santa Cruz or Carl Frampton,” sabi ng 33-anyos na tubong Ta-libon, Bohol sa pana-yam ng ESPN Deportes.
Nakatakdang idepensa ni Donaire ang kanyang suot na World Boxing Organization welterweight crown laban kay Magdaleno (23-0-0, 17 KOs) sa undercard ng bakbakan nina Manny Pacquiao at Jessie Vargas.
Si Donaire, nagkampeon sa flyweight, super flyweight, bantamweight, super bantamweight at featherweight divisions, ang sinasabing susunod sa yapak ng 37-anyos na si Pacquiao.
Hinirang si Donaire bilang Fighter of the Year matapos talunin sina dating world champions Israel Vazquez, Jr., Jeffrey Mathebula, Toshiaki Nishioka at Jorge Arce.
“I’m a warrior and I want the big fights. Expect me in big fights at 126 pounds,” wika ni Donaire, sinasanay ni Cuban trainer Ismael Salas.
“This November 5th you will see a new era, that is what Ismael Salas has given me. They will see a different Nonito, with very strong mentality, from this point mo-ving forward.”
Minsan nang naging trainer ni Magdaleno si Salas.
“I know Ismael Salas trained Jessie Magdaleno, but really we do not focus on that. I’m at an incre-dible level. Ismael has brought out the best of me. I’m more focused on what I’m doing when I’m with,” ani Donaire. (RC)
